/* * arch/powerpc/platforms/83xx/mpc834x_sys.c * * MPC834x SYS board specific routines * * Maintainer: Kumar Gala <galak@kernel.crashing.org> * * This program is free software; you can redistribute  it and/or modify it * under  the terms of  the GNU General  Public License as published by the * Free Software Foundation;  either version 2 of the  License, or (at your * option) any later version. */#include <linux/config.h>#include <linux/stddef.h>#include <linux/kernel.h>#include <linux/init.h>#include <linux/errno.h>#include <linux/reboot.h>#include <linux/pci.h>#include <linux/kdev_t.h>#include <linux/major.h>#include <linux/console.h>#include <linux/delay.h>#include <linux/seq_file.h>#include <linux/root_dev.h>#include <asm/system.h>#include <asm/atomic.h>#include <asm/time.h>#include <asm/io.h>#include <asm/machdep.h>#include <asm/ipic.h>#include <asm/bootinfo.h>#include <asm/irq.h>#include <asm/prom.h>#include <asm/udbg.h>#include <sysdev/fsl_soc.h>#include "mpc83xx.h"#ifndef CONFIG_PCIunsigned long isa_io_base = 0;unsigned long isa_mem_base = 0;#endif#ifdef CONFIG_PCIstatic intmpc83xx_map_irq(struct pci_dev *dev, unsigned char idsel, unsigned char pin){	static char pci_irq_table[][4] =	    /*	     *      PCI IDSEL/INTPIN->INTLINE	     *       A      B      C      D	     */	{		{PIRQA, PIRQB, PIRQC, PIRQD},	/* idsel 0x11 */		{PIRQC, PIRQD, PIRQA, PIRQB},	/* idsel 0x12 */		{PIRQD, PIRQA, PIRQB, PIRQC},	/* idsel 0x13 */		{0, 0, 0, 0},		{PIRQA, PIRQB, PIRQC, PIRQD},	/* idsel 0x15 */		{PIRQD, PIRQA, PIRQB, PIRQC},	/* idsel 0x16 */		{PIRQC, PIRQD, PIRQA, PIRQB},	/* idsel 0x17 */		{PIRQB, PIRQC, PIRQD, PIRQA},	/* idsel 0x18 */		{0, 0, 0, 0},			/* idsel 0x19 */		{0, 0, 0, 0},			/* idsel 0x20 */	};	const long min_idsel = 0x11, max_idsel = 0x20, irqs_per_slot = 4;	return PCI_IRQ_TABLE_LOOKUP;}#endif				/* CONFIG_PCI *//* ************************************************************************ * * Setup the architecture * */static void __init mpc834x_sys_setup_arch(void){	struct device_node *np;	if (ppc_md.progress)		ppc_md.progress("mpc834x_sys_setup_arch()", 0);	np = of_find_node_by_type(NULL, "cpu");	if (np != 0) {		unsigned int *fp =		    (int *)get_property(np, "clock-frequency", NULL);		if (fp != 0)			loops_per_jiffy = *fp / HZ;		else			loops_per_jiffy = 50000000 / HZ;		of_node_put(np);	}#ifdef CONFIG_PCI	for (np = NULL; (np = of_find_node_by_type(np, "pci")) != NULL;)		add_bridge(np);	ppc_md.pci_swizzle = common_swizzle;	ppc_md.pci_map_irq = mpc83xx_map_irq;	ppc_md.pci_exclude_device = mpc83xx_exclude_device;#endif#ifdef  CONFIG_ROOT_NFS	ROOT_DEV = Root_NFS;#else	ROOT_DEV = Root_HDA1;#endif}void __init mpc834x_sys_init_IRQ(void){	u8 senses[8] = {		0,			/* EXT 0 */		IRQ_SENSE_LEVEL,	/* EXT 1 */		IRQ_SENSE_LEVEL,	/* EXT 2 */		0,			/* EXT 3 */#ifdef CONFIG_PCI		IRQ_SENSE_LEVEL,	/* EXT 4 */		IRQ_SENSE_LEVEL,	/* EXT 5 */		IRQ_SENSE_LEVEL,	/* EXT 6 */		IRQ_SENSE_LEVEL,	/* EXT 7 */#else		0,			/* EXT 4 */		0,			/* EXT 5 */		0,			/* EXT 6 */		0,			/* EXT 7 */#endif	};	ipic_init(get_immrbase() + 0x00700, 0, 0, senses, 8);	/* Initialize the default interrupt mapping priorities,	 * in case the boot rom changed something on us.	 */	ipic_set_default_priority();}#if defined(CONFIG_I2C_MPC) && defined(CONFIG_SENSORS_DS1374)extern ulong ds1374_get_rtc_time(void);extern int ds1374_set_rtc_time(ulong);static int __init mpc834x_rtc_hookup(void){	struct timespec tv;	ppc_md.get_rtc_time = ds1374_get_rtc_time;	ppc_md.set_rtc_time = ds1374_set_rtc_time;	tv.tv_nsec = 0;	tv.tv_sec = (ppc_md.get_rtc_time) ();	do_settimeofday(&tv);	return 0;}late_initcall(mpc834x_rtc_hookup);#endif/* * Called very early, MMU is off, device-tree isn't unflattened */static int __init mpc834x_sys_probe(void){	/* We always match for now, eventually we should look at the flat	   dev tree to ensure this is the board we are suppose to run on	*/	return 1;}define_machine(mpc834x_sys) {	.name			= "MPC834x SYS",	.probe			= mpc834x_sys_probe,	.setup_arch		= mpc834x_sys_setup_arch,	.init_IRQ		= mpc834x_sys_init_IRQ,	.get_irq		= ipic_get_irq,	.restart		= mpc83xx_restart,	.time_init		= mpc83xx_time_init,	.calibrate_decr		= generic_calibrate_decr,	.progress		= udbg_progress,};
